  • Description

    Methylergometrin, also known as methylergonovine, primarily acts as an agonist at specific serotonin receptors, mainly 5-HT2A and 5-HT2B subtypes, which are predominantly found in the smooth muscle fibers of the uterus. By stimulating these receptors, methylergometrin causes rapid and direct contraction of the uterine smooth muscle, leading to the constriction of blood vessels and reduced postpartum bleeding. This mechanism of action is particularly useful in the management of postpartum hemorrhage, as it aids in the rapid involution of the uterus and the control of bleeding.

  • Uses

    The following are the uses of Methylergometrin 0.2mg injection:

    • Used for controlling bleeding after childbirth
    • Used to induce uterine contractions
    • Used to treat severe postpartum hemorrhage
    • Used for managing incomplete or missed abortions
    • Used to prevent and treat uterine atony
    • Used for managing excessive bleeding during menstruation
    • Used post-delivery to prevent bleeding and infection

  • When Not to Use

    Following are the conditions when Methylergometrin 0.2mg injection should not be administered:

    • Allergic reactions Should not be used if the patient has a known allergy or hypersensitivity to methylergometrine or other ergot alkaloids.
    • Pregnancy Contraindicated in pregnant women, especially during the first trimester, as it may restrict blood flow to the uterus and affect fetal development.
    • Postpartum hypertension Should not be used in women with high blood pressure after childbirth, as it may increase blood pressure further.
    • Migraine or vascular disease Not recommended for individuals with a history of severe migraine, heart disease, or blood vessel disorders.
    • Liver or kidney impairment Methylergometrin should be avoided in patients with liver or kidney problems as it is primarily metabolized in the liver and excreted by the kidneys.
    • Epilepsy Not suitable for patients with a history of seizures or epilepsy.
    • Infections Should not be administered in cases of severe infections, as it may mask the symptoms and delay appropriate treatment.
    • Thrombosis or embolism Contraindicated in individuals with a history of blood clots or embolisms, as it can increase the risk of these conditions.
    • Raynaud's disease Should not be used in patients with Raynaud's disease, as it can worsen the symptoms.
  • Side Effects

    The side effects of Methylergometrin 0.2mg injection may include:

    • Nausea and vomiting
    • Abdominal pain
    • Headache
    • Dizziness or lightheadedness
    • High blood pressure (hypertension)
    • Slow or irregular heartbeat
    • Chest pain
    • Allergic reactions (skin rash, itching, difficulty breathing)
  • Precautions & Warnings

    Following are the precautions and warnings for Methylergometrin 0.2mg injection:

    • Methylergometrin should be used with caution in patients with hypertension, as it may cause a sudden increase in blood pressure.
    • Patients with a history of cardiovascular disease should be closely monitored, as this medication can affect heart rate and rhythm.
    • It is important to avoid prolonged use, as it may lead to fibrosis and necrosis at the injection site.
    • Methylergometrin should not be used during pregnancy, especially in the first trimester, as it can cause uterine contractions and harm the fetus.
    • Breastfeeding women should exercise caution, as the drug may pass into breast milk and affect the infant.
    • This medication should not be used in patients with severe liver or kidney disease without careful monitoring.
    • Methylergometrin can cause severe headaches and migraines; patients with a history of migraines should use it with caution.
    • Do not use this injection if there is any sign of infection or thrombosis at the injection site.
  • Drug Interactions

    Following are the drug interactions for Methylergometrin 0.2mg injection:

    • It should not be used with other ergot alkaloids due to the risk of additive vasospasm and ergotism.
    • The effects of Methylergometrin may be reduced by drugs like bromocriptine and cabergoline, which are dopamine agonists.
    • Antihypertensive medications may have their blood pressure-lowering effects diminished by Methylergometrin.
    • Caution is advised when using Methylergometrin with drugs that prolong QT interval, as it may increase the risk of arrhythmias.
    • The vasoconstrictive effects of Methylergometrin can be increased by sympathomimetic agents, leading to hypertension.
    • The absorption of Methylergometrin may be decreased by antacids containing aluminum hydroxide or magnesium hydroxide.
    • Methylergometrin can interact with general anesthetics, increasing the risk of hypertension and vasoconstriction during surgery.
